The Thailand Mobile User Authentication Market was estimated at USD 229 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 261 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 2.2% from 2026 to 2032.

A key restraint in the Thailand Mobile User Authentication Market is the challenge of balancing security and convenience. Many users are averse to complex authentication processes, leading to potential disengagement from services. As companies implement stronger measures, they must also consider user experience, ensuring that security does not come at the cost of usability. This tension can hinder widespread adoption of more secure solutions, particularly among less tech-savvy users.
Several trends are currently shaping the Thailand Mobile User Authentication Market. The integration of artificial intelligence into authentication processes is gaining traction, enhancing the ability to detect fraudulent activities in real-time. Additionally, the rise of digital identity frameworks is prompting enterprises to adopt multi-layered security approaches. Social engineering attacks also fuel a demand for more sophisticated authentication methods, pushing organizations to rethink their security protocols.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
